Boot Mobility Scooter
Boot mobility scooters are tiny class 2 scooters that fold down or disassembled to transport in the back of a car. They can be used on pavements or indoors.

They are simple to maintain.
Scooters are a life-changing device for a lot of people with disabilities or a limited mobility. They allow people to move around on their own, and if they are well maintained and looked after, they can be a great solution for mobility and transport.
When choosing a new scooter to purchase, it is crucial to select one that fits your budget and requirements. It should be simple to maintain and repair, as well as able to withstand rough terrain.
It is a good idea to keep your scooter clean and avoid letting it be in contact with water. This can cause corrosion and make the scooter less durable.
Tyres are a vital component of your scooter and must be inspected frequently for wear, particularly around the sidewalls and tread. In the event of wear, they can impact your scooter's braking and performance in cornering.
Some prefer pneumatic tyres because they are more durable. They are also more comfortable to ride on, however they'll need to be replaced periodically.
